How To Choose the Right Patio Layout for Furniture Arrangement

Choosing the perfect layout for your small patio can make all the difference in how you enjoy your outdoor space. A well-thought-out furniture arrangement not only maximizes your area but also enhances your outdoor experience. Here are some essential criteria to consider when planning your patio layout. 1. Size & Scale Start by measuring your patio’s dimensions. Knowing the size helps you select furniture that fits well without overcrowding the space. Ideally, leave about 3 feet of walking space between pieces to ensure comfort and accessibility. Use tape to mark where you plan to place each item, visualizing the layout before making any purchases.

2. Functionality Think about how you plan to use your patio. Will it be for dining, lounging, or entertaining guests? If you have limited space, consider multi-functional furniture, like a bench that doubles as storage or foldable chairs. This approach allows you to adapt your space for different occasions without sacrificing comfort.

3. Style & Aesthetics Your outdoor furniture design should reflect your personal style. Choose a theme that complements your home and garden. Whether you prefer modern minimalist pieces or rustic wooden furniture, ensure that your selections harmonize with the overall aesthetic. Mixing materials can also add character; for example, combine metal chairs with a wooden table to create an inviting look.

4. Materials & Durability Consider the materials of your outdoor furniture. Look for weather-resistant options like aluminum, teak, or wicker that can withstand the elements. If you live in a rainy or sunny area, durable materials will ensure longevity and reduce wear and tear. Check for UV protection and rust-resistant features to keep your investment lasting for years.

5. Comfort & Seating Arrangements Comfort is key when choosing garden seating arrangements. Opt for cushions and throws in easy-to-clean fabrics for added coziness. Arrange seating to promote conversation; for instance, position chairs around a central coffee table or fire pit. This layout invites interaction and creates a warm environment for gatherings.

6. Budget Finally, set a budget before you start shopping. Knowing your financial limits helps you make smart choices and prevents overspending. Look for sales or second-hand options to find quality pieces at a lower price. Remember, investing in durable furniture can save money in the long run.

How can I arrange outdoor furniture in a tiny patio without sacrificing comfort?

Comfort comes from modular, flexible pieces you can reconfigure for guests.

Ensure pathways stay clear and wide enough for traffic—aim for at least 2.5 to 3 feet between seating and obstacles.

Choose outdoor furniture design that fits your space, like armless chairs, slim benches, and stackable stools, plus weatherproof cushions for year-round use.

Keep layout simple with a single focal point to reduce clutter and make the space feel larger.
